Bengaluru, Aug. 26 -- Karnataka BJP President Vijayendra Yediyurappa today alleged that the ruling Congress was deliberately creating controversies and then portraying itself as a victim to garner sympathy.
"Nobody is naive to ignore this Congress party's act of rocking the cradle while pinching the baby," Vijayendra said, taking to social media, accusing the leadership of orchestrating disputes while pretending to protect public sentiments.
